What is AVIF?
AVIF stands for AV1 Image File Format, a cutting-edge image format developed by the Alliance for Open Media. It leverages the AV1 video codec to offer superior compression and image quality compared to traditional formats like JPEG, PNG, and even WebP.
AVIF supports advanced features such as:
-
Lossless and lossy compression
-
High Dynamic Range (HDR)
-
Transparency (alpha channel)
-
Wide color gamut support
Benefits of Using AVIF for Websites
1. Significantly Smaller File Sizes
One of the most compelling advantages of AVIF is its high compression efficiency. Compared to JPEG, AVIF can reduce image sizes by up to 50% without compromising visual quality. This leads to:
-
Faster page load times
-
Lower bandwidth usage
-
Improved mobile performance
2. Enhanced Visual Quality
AVIF maintains sharpness, details, and clarity even at smaller sizes. Unlike older formats, it supports 10-bit and 12-bit color depths, enabling vibrant visuals and realistic rendering.
3. Modern Browser Support
AVIF is now supported by major browsers, including:
-
Google Chrome
-
Mozilla Firefox
-
Microsoft Edge
-
Opera
-
Safari (with iOS 16 and macOS Ventura)
This widespread support ensures a seamless user experience across devices.
4. Future-Proof Format
Backed by industry giants like Google, Netflix, and Amazon, AVIF is future-ready and continues to evolve with emerging media trends.
How to Convert Images to AVIF
Efficiently converting images to AVIF involves the right tools and practices. Here’s how you can do it:
1. Using Command Line Tools
For developers and advanced users, tools like libavif or avifenc offer high-quality conversions.
Example using avifenc:
bash CopyEdit avifenc input.jpg output.avifPros:
-
High control over compression levels
-
Batch processing capabilities
Cons:
-
Requires installation and command line knowledge
2. Using Online Converters
For quick and easy conversions, online AVIF converters are ideal.
Popular tools include:
-
Squoosh (by Google)
-
CloudConvert
-
Convertio
-
AVIF.io
These platforms allow users to upload images and receive AVIF files with customizable settings.
Pros:
-
No installation needed
-
User-friendly interfaces
Cons:
-
Upload limitations
-
Privacy concerns for sensitive content
3. Using Image Editing Software
Tools like Adobe Photoshop (with plugins) or GIMP (with AVIF extension) can also export images in AVIF format.
Photoshop AVIF Plugin:
-
Install the plugin
-
Open your image
-
Export using “Save As AVIF”
This method works best for graphic designers or marketers who frequently edit and optimize images.
Best Practices for Implementing AVIF on Websites
1. Use Fallbacks for Browser Compatibility
Even though AVIF has broad support, not all browsers may display it properly. Use the <picture> HTML tag to provide fallback formats like WebP or JPEG.
Example:
html CopyEdit <picture> <source srcset="image.avif" type="image/avif"> <source srcset="image.webp" type="image/webp"> <img src="image.jpg" alt="Example image"> </picture>2. Automate AVIF Conversion in Workflows
For large-scale websites, use automation tools in your CI/CD pipelines to convert and optimize AVIF images on the fly.
Popular plugins and packages:
-
ImageMagick with AVIF support
-
Sharp (Node.js image processing library)
-
Gatsby/Image or Next.js Image components
3. Optimize Compression Levels
Test different compression levels to strike the perfect balance between quality and performance. Over-compressing can degrade image clarity.
Recommended setting:
-
Start with cq-level 30–40 for general web use
-
Adjust based on image type (e.g., photos vs. icons)
4. Use Lazy Loading for Better Performance
Combine AVIF with lazy loading to reduce initial page weight and boost page speed scores.
HTML Example:

SEO and Page Speed Gains with AVIF
Using AVIF images has a direct impact on Core Web Vitals, the key metrics Google uses to assess website performance:
-
Largest Contentful Paint (LCP): AVIF reduces image load times, improving LCP.
-
First Input Delay (FID): Faster page loads lead to more responsive interactions.
-
Cumulative Layout Shift (CLS): With properly sized AVIFs, layout shifts can be minimized.
Faster pages = better user experience = higher rankings.
